WELCOME MESSAGES<br />
Message from the IASSIDD President-Elect, Dr. Philip W. Davidson<br />
Dear Colleagues and Friends,<br />
On behalf of the many people who have worked on planning<br />
the 15 th World Congress, welcome to Melbourne! We hope<br />
you like the meetings and this wonderful city.<br />
The guiding force behind our planning efforts has been to<br />
foster partnerships and collaborations across the globe to<br />
undertake research in our field that can be translated to<br />
policies and practices that improve the lives of people with<br />
intellectual and developmental disabilities. To that end, the<br />
program has some features that we hope moves us all closer<br />
to that goal. We have included 23 separate topical tracks<br />
that reach across many scientific disciplines and<br />
methodologies. We have tried to adopt strategies that are<br />
designed to engage presenters and attendees in dialogue. We have made a<br />
special effort to embrace participation on the scientific program by self-advocates.<br />
And we have tried very hard to engage scientists and self-advocates in developing<br />
countries and regions of the world where the majority of the global population<br />
reside.<br />
I am very interested in hearing from you both while we are here in Melbourne and<br />
afterward, about how we did.<br />
